Data Format Detailed Descriptions & Data Interpretation
30007 Y1_output IEEE754 Analog Output of Y1
30009 Y2_output IEEE754 Analog Output fo Y2
30011 TempUnit IEEE754 For RWD32S Temp Unit
0: Celsius
1: Fahrenheit
30013 SensorType IEEE754 For RWD32S Sensor Type
0: NI 1000
1: PI 1000
30015 D1_func IEEE754 For RWD34/44/45 only,
Function Setting for Input D1
0: ON/OFF
1: Day/Night
2: Alarm
3: Filter Alarm
30017 UNIT IEEE754 For RWD32/62/68/82 & RWD34/44/45,
Unit Setting for Input X1
0: Celsius
1: Fahrenheit
2: Null
3: %
30019 UNIT3 IEEE754 For RWD34/44/45,
Unit Setting for Input X3
0: Celsius
1: Fahrenheit
2: %
3: Null
4: Remote monitoring
30021 TYPE1 IEEE754 For RWD32/62/68/82 & RWD34/44/45,
Selection of Sensor Type for Input X1
0: Ni1000
1: Pt1000
2: 0 to 10 V
3: VR
30023 TYPE2 IEEE754 For RWD32/62/68/82 & RWD34/44/45,
Selection of Sensor Type for Input X2
0: Ni1000
1: Pt1000
2: 0 to 10 V
3: VR or Digital Input
30025 TYPE3 IEEE754 For RWD34/44/45,
Selection of Sensor Type for Input X3
0: Ni1000
1: Pt1000
2: 0 to 10 V
3: VR or Digital Input
30027 Compressor_Stage IEEE754 Compress Stage Selection Status:
1: Stage1
2: Stage2
